2026秋招:软件开发工程师面试题及答案.docVIP

  • 4
  • 0
  • 约2.5千字
  • 约 9页
  • 2026-03-11 发布于广东
  • 举报

2026秋招:软件开发工程师面试题及答案.doc

2026秋招:软件开发工程师面试题及答案

单项选择题(每题2分,共20分)

1.Java中哪个关键字用于继承类?

A.extends

B.implements

C.inherit

D.super

2.Python中用于创建空字典的是?

A.{}

B.[]

C.()

D.

3.SQL中用于删除表的语句是?

A.DELETE

B.DROP

C.REMOVE

D.TRUNCATE

4.以下哪种排序算法平均时间复杂度最低?

A.冒泡排序

B.插入排序

C.快速排序

D.选择排序

5.面向对象编程中,封装的目的是?

A.提高程序效率

B.隐藏数据和方法实现

C.实现多态

D.方便继承

6.C++中,以下哪个用来声明引用?

A.

B.

C.@

D.

7.JavaScript中,数组的pop方法作用是?

A.在数组末尾添加元素

B.删除数组第一个元素

C.删除数组最后一个元素

D.反转数组顺序

8.Linux系统中,创建目录的命令是?

A.mkdir

B.rmdir

C.cd

D.ls

9.软件生命周期中,哪个阶段主要进行软件的功能和性能测试?

A.需求分析

B.设计阶段

C.编码阶段

D.测试阶段

10.数据库中,外键的作用是?

A.保证数据的唯一性

B.建立表之间的

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档